Numerai GP LLC lessened its holdings in Haemonetics Co. (NYSE:HAE - Free Report) by 60.4%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 5,968 shares of the medical instruments supplier's stock after selling 9,111 shares during the quarter. Numerai GP LLC's holdings in Haemonetics were worth $466,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Haemonetics Stock Performance
Shares of NYSE HAE traded down $0.92 during mid-day trading on Monday, reaching $69.39. 344,207 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 699,066. Haemonetics Co. has a 52 week low of $55.30 and a 52 week high of $95.53.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.35, a current ratio of 3.97 and a quick ratio of 2.55. The firm has a 50-day moving average price of $62.92 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$71.21. The firm has a market capitalization of $3.49 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 27.32,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.11 and a beta of 0.32.
Haemonetics (NYSE:HAE -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, May 8th. The medical instruments supplier reported $1.24 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$1.22 by $0.02. The firm had revenue of $330.60 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$329.38 million. Haemonetics had a net margin of 9.47% and a return on equity of 23.66%. The company's quarterly revenue was down 3.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$0.90 earnings per share. Analysts predict that Haemonetics Co. will post 4.55 EPS for the current year.

Haemonetics Profile
(
Free Report)
Haemonetics Corporation, a healthcare company, provides suite of medical products and solutions in the United States and internationally. The company offers automated plasma collection systems, donor management software, and supporting software solutions including NexSys PCS and PCS2 plasmapheresis equipment and related disposables and solutions, as well as integrated information technology platforms for plasma customers to manage their donors, operations, and supply chain; and NexLynk DMS donor management system and Donor360 app.
